Hi, one of cousin didn't have uterus, so that she didn't attain puberty. I ve checked in internet, says that 1 in 5000 will suffer by this. Is there any solution for this.

Hi, There is no solution for this as it is a congenital problem. When the organ is not developed in the foetus, nothing can be done later. That is why foetal anamoly scan is done during 20th week of pregnancy to know whether all the organs are formed well and thus detect the defects at that stage itself.
